Wire the RTL8721F km4tz core up to a working NuttShell: - irq.h: renumber the KM4TZ external vector table to the RTL8721F APIRQn map (UART_LOG=24, IPC=5, +GPIOB/C, TIMER7/8, ...). - ameba_loguart.c: fix the LOG-UART base to 0x40810000. The former 0x401C6000 belongs to a different Ameba part; the wrong base bus- faulted on the RX interrupt-enable write while TX still worked (LOGUART_PutChar uses its own ROM-internal base). - ameba_app_start.c: adjust the MPU read-only / RAM regions for the RTL8721F memory map and seed the RTC on first power-on so the SDM32K-clocked SYSTIMER comes up (mirrors the SDK app_rtc_init). - ameba_ipc.c: move the km4tz<->km4ns IPC to APIRQn 5 (IPC_CPU0). - ameba_board.mk: pull in fwlib ameba_rtc.c for the RTC_* symbols. - defconfig: RTL8721F RAM map, enable TIMER/TIMER_ARCH/ARMV8M_SYSTICK for a live system tick, and drop the WiFi/NET stack for now. - scripts/Make.defs: use the RTL8721F_NOR flash profile. Boots cleanly to nsh> on hardware; tick, RX and builtin apps verified. Signed-off-by: dechao_gong <dechao_gong@realsil.com.cn> |
